Job Summary:

  • Projects may involve exploration of products and/or process problems, definition and selection of new concepts and approaches, origination or modification of material, component and process specifications and requirements.
  • During this internship, you will have an opportunity to:
  • Apply electrical engineering principles in the design and analysis of components, sub system and system.
  • Utilize engineering tools to design and optimize your designs (microprocessor based, mixed signal embedded systems ADC/DAC control, sensor signal conditioning using op-amps, electro-optic systems, and motor control).
  • Design and set up experiments, collect data, and write test protocol and qualification reports.
  • Electrical System Design and Integration, System-Level Testing Support, Schematic Capture, Bug Resolution.
  • Diagnose and investigate the root-cause of part, assembly or design failures using proven Danaher system for problem solving.
  • Learn and implement the DBS approach to problem solving and product development.
  • Communicate and collaborate with multiple teams and stakeholders to provide updates and provide task deliverables.
  • Support prototype and production pilot builds and resolve technical and quality issues.
  • Maintain, update and support the release of product functional specifications.
  • Work closely with senior engineers to develop and test new design and support analysis tasks.
  • Work on substantive projects that have the potential to impact the future business of the company.
  • Present the projects they have been involved with and lessons learned to the R&D team.

Minimum Requirements:

  • Currently pursuing a Bachelor's or Master's deg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ering or Applied Physics
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Applications (Word, Excel, Power Point, Visio, Project)
  • Strong problem solving and analysis skills
  • Basic understanding of mechanical, electrical, and/or optical components
  • Course work on electronics circuit designs, computer programming and digital systems
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ills required
  • Ability to interact effectively with a wide variety of people and departments within the company
  • Ability to work in an office and engineering lab environment
  • Walking or standing within office area is routinely required; bending, kneeling, and stretching may be required for the operation of equipment

Biosafety Information:

  • As part of Cepheid's Biosafety and Bloodborne Pathogen Exposure Control Plan, any associate who will be working with biohazardous materials or those who are required to work where others are using biohazardous materials, will be required to show proof of Hepatitis B Vaccination and take a biosafety training.
  • For associates who are not vaccinated but are willing to be, Cepheid will schedule the vaccination with our occupational health clinic before the intern goes into the lab.
  • Hiring managers and Cepheid's Biosafety Officer will determine which internships fall under this requirement.
